McIntosh MA352 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Total Harmonic Distortion0.03%
Number of Channels2
Speaker Impedance4, 8 Ohms
Rated Power Band20Hz to 20kHz
Headphone OutputYes
Home Theater PassThruYes
TypeIntegrated Amplifier
Input Impedance (Line)20K ohms
Input Impedance (MM)47K ohms, 50pF
Frequency Response+0, -0.5dB from 20Hz to 20kHz
Signal to Noise Ratio100dB
Preamplifier Inputs1 Balanced
Variable Output1
Phono InputMoving Magnet
Vacuum Tube or Solid StateHybrid (Vacuum Tube and Solid State)
Vacuum Tube Complement2 x 12AX7A, 1 x 12AT7
Input Sensitivity0.5V (Balanced)
Input Impedance20K ohms Balanced, 20K ohms Unbalanced
